Program Analysis

Graduates earn $26,176/yr, roughly in line with the $29,875 national median for Ecology & Evolution. The value proposition here depends on cost, not earnings.

A 7.8x earnings multiple over ten years puts this program in solid financial territory. Tuition is well-justified by projected earnings.

The 7% difference between AI scenarios reflects partial automation exposure. Some Ecology & Evolution career paths face displacement, but others in the field are more insulated.

At $20,500 against $26,176/yr in earnings, the debt burden is moderate. Most graduates should manage repayment without extended financial strain.

A #48 ranking among 64 Ecology & Evolution programs places University of Rhode Island in the lower half. Price, proximity, and personal fit become the stronger arguments.

The $26,176-to-$45,950 earnings arc over five years reflects a 76% gain — well above average career growth for recent graduates.
